  • Patent number: 10409623
    Abstract: Outputs from a graphical user interface of a target computer program are captured during actual use of the target computer program. The captured outputs are processed to recognize strings and associate those strings with content derived from the outputs. The recognized strings and associated content are stored as context data. A translation editing tool accesses the context data and message data of the target computer program. The translation editing tool presents the message data through a graphical user interface to a user. In response to selected text from the message data, the context data are accessed to retrieve content associated with a recognized string that matches the selected text. The retrieved content is presented in the graphical user interface of the translation editing tool to provide contextual information to inform how to translate a message. Text input from the translator can be stored in the message data.
